Sacred Scents: A Bespoke Perfume Workshop

  • Talk
  • Workshop

This Easter step into the sensorial world of ancient ritual at Sacred Scents, a special edition of the beloved workshop series by the Hellenic Museum and Greek-Australian fragrance house Thematikos.

Explore the remarkable 'Rituals: Gifts for the Gods' collection on loan from the Hellenic Ministry of Culture before blending a signature fragrance with guidance from Thematikos artisans.

Take home not just a unique scent, but a deeper understanding of how the ancients connected to the divine through the senses.

This experience includes museum general entry on the day, a 30-minute guided tour, followed by a 90-minute fragrance-blending session and everything needed to create a 50ml bespoke eau de parfum.
